Summary:
Paperback Edition: Updated and with a New Foreword. The nation will not soon forget the drama of the 2000 presidential election. For five weeks we were transfixed by the legal clashes that enveloped the country from election night to the Gore concession. It was instant history, and will be studied by historians, lawyers, political scientists, media critics and others for years to come. Even for those who followed the events most closely, the legal twists and turns of the post-election struggles seemed at times bewildering. Contents:
Winning the presidency : the electoral vote
Manual recounts: in Florida and across the nation
Protesting the election: what sort of deadline was November 14?
Contesting the election: what does the law mean by "rejection of legal votes"?
Challenging hand counts in Federal Court : the seed is planted
The "safe-harbor" provision and article II of the Constitution: did the Florida Supreme Court rewrite Florida law?
Article II of the U.S. Constitution : did the Florida Supreme Court improperly rely on the Florida Constitution?
The U.S. Supreme Court asks for clarification : the Florida Supreme Court responds
The U.S. Supreme Court ends the election : the unconstitutionality of Florida's hand counts and the ultimate significance of December 12
The "butterfly ballot" : Palm Beach county and 3,407 Buchanan votes
Absentee ballots: Seminole and Martin counties and a printer's error
The Florida legislature: what was its proper role?
The U.S. Congress : the unused court of last resort.
